Agilent's Life Science/ Chemical Analysis Group (LSCA) is a leading provider of analytical instrument systems that enable customers to identify, quantify, analyze and test the molecular, physical and biological properties of thousands of substances and products. LSCA has five sites worldwide: Waldbronn in Germany, Little Falls and Palo Alto in the USA, Tokyo in Japan, and Shanghai in China.

As a recent graduated in Chemistry, Biochemistry or Biology you have the responsibility of supporting our clients for on-site installation, implementation, maintenance and repair of many of the quality products that we manufacture and sell. This can be very complex multimillion dollar projects around LC, LC/MS, GC, GC/MS and Atomic Spectroscopy instruments etc. complete with the appropriate software solutions. Additionally, you will use your consulting skills and improve customer satisfaction by proactively advising customers on preventive maintenance and configurations, which may impact product performance.
